Transaction 240821be5086d53d96e9498696ccedb742332671545cf5c720602887f789032f
1 Input
1 Output
-
240821be5086d53d96e9498696ccedb742332671545cf5c720602887f789032f:0
- value
- 710848
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5e5423a217b763b815f70f36d830353de1694fea OP_EQUAL
- address
- 3AHnEfn1TrW4bntzmBg8qAF5PCZ9HsXmgV